
要在Excel中将度分秒转换为弧度,可以使用公式、函数和特定的步骤来完成。 具体方法包括:使用Excel的内置函数、手动计算公式、以及一些常用的技巧来确保精度。下面将详细介绍这些方法中的一种。
使用Excel的内置函数
Excel有几个函数可以帮助我们将度、分、秒转换为弧度。主要的函数包括DEGREES、RADIANS、CONVERT等。接下来我们将详细介绍这些函数的使用方法。
一、DEGREES 和 RADIANS 函数
-
DEGREES 函数:这个函数可以将弧度转换为度。其语法为:
=DEGREES(弧度)其中,
弧度是要转换为度的角度值。 -
RADIANS 函数:这个函数可以将度转换为弧度。其语法为:
=RADIANS(度)其中,
度是要转换为弧度的角度值。
二、度分秒转换公式
度分秒 (DMS) 通常用来表示角度,其中度 (degrees) 是整数,分 (minutes) 和秒 (seconds) 是小数。为了将度分秒转换为弧度,我们可以使用以下公式:
弧度 = (度 + 分/60 + 秒/3600) * π / 180
这里的 π 是圆周率,可以在Excel中通过 PI() 函数获取。
三、手动计算
假设我们有如下的度分秒数据:
- 度 (D) 在单元格 A1
- 分 (M) 在单元格 B1
- 秒 (S) 在单元格 C1
我们可以使用以下步骤将其转换为弧度:
-
将度分秒转换为十进制度:
十进制度 = A1 + B1/60 + C1/3600 -
将十进制度转换为弧度:
弧度 = 十进制度 * PI() / 180
在Excel中,这两个步骤可以合并为一个公式:
= (A1 + B1/60 + C1/3600) * PI() / 180
四、具体操作步骤
-
输入数据:
- 在A列输入度数值
- 在B列输入分数值
- 在C列输入秒数值
-
应用公式:
在D列输入公式:
= (A1 + B1/60 + C1/3600) * PI() / 180然后按回车键,D1单元格将显示转换后的弧度值。
-
复制公式:
将D1单元格的公式向下复制,以便对其他行的数据进行相同的转换。
五、实际应用案例
假设我们有一组天文学数据,需要将度分秒转换为弧度,以便在天文计算中使用。以下是具体的示例和步骤:
示例数据
| 度数 (D) | 分数 (M) | 秒数 (S) |
|---|---|---|
| 23 | 34 | 45 |
| 12 | 22 | 33 |
| 45 | 56 | 12 |
转换公式
在Excel中,使用上述公式可以将这些数据转换为弧度:
- 在D列输入公式:
= (A2 + B2/60 + C2/3600) * PI() / 180 - 复制公式到D2:D4,以便对所有行的数据进行转换。
转换结果
| 度数 (D) | 分数 (M) | 秒数 (S) | 弧度 |
|---|---|---|---|
| 23 | 34 | 45 | 0.411546 |
| 12 | 22 | 33 | 0.215375 |
| 45 | 56 | 12 | 0.801106 |
六、Excel宏自动化转换
如果需要频繁进行度分秒到弧度的转换,可以编写一个Excel宏来自动化这个过程。以下是一个简单的VBA宏示例:
Sub ConvertDMSToRadians()
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1")
Dim lastRow As Long
lastRow = ws.Cells(ws.Rows.Count, "A").End(xlUp).Row
Dim i As Long
For i = 2 To lastRow
Dim degrees As Double
Dim minutes As Double
Dim seconds As Double
Dim radians As Double
degrees = ws.Cells(i, 1).Value
minutes = ws.Cells(i, 2).Value
seconds = ws.Cells(i, 3).Value
radians = (degrees + minutes / 60 + seconds / 3600) * WorksheetFunction.Pi() / 180
ws.Cells(i, 4).Value = radians
Next i
End Sub
结论
通过上述方法,可以在Excel中轻松将度分秒转换为弧度。 具体方法包括使用Excel的内置函数、手动计算公式和编写VBA宏。选择适合的方法可以大大提高工作效率和准确性。
相关问答FAQs:
1. 什么是度分秒和弧度的转换?
度分秒和弧度是表示角度的不同单位,度分秒是常用的角度单位,而弧度是数学中常用的角度单位。度分秒和弧度之间可以进行相互转换。
2. 如何将度分秒转换为弧度?
将度分秒转换为弧度的公式为:弧度 = (度 + 分/60 + 秒/3600) * π/180。首先将度、分、秒分别转换为对应的小数,然后将其相加,最后乘以π/180即可得到弧度值。
3. 如何将弧度转换为度分秒?
将弧度转换为度分秒的公式为:度 = 弧度 * 180/π,分 = (度 – 整数部分) * 60,秒 = (分 – 整数部分) * 60。首先将弧度乘以180/π,得到度的小数值,然后将度的小数值转换为度、分、秒的形式即可。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4892850